UK Urges All Citizens to Avoid Travel to Israel as Conflict with Iran Intensifies

The UK government has issued its highest-level travel warning for Israel, as the nation endures a third consecutive day of air strikes targeting Iranian cities, and Iranian missiles continue to hit central Israel.

The Foreign, Commonwealth & Development Office (FCDO) now officially advises against all travel to Israel, following a rapid escalation of hostilities that has already claimed dozens of lives and disrupted airspace across the region.


Situation Rapidly Deteriorating

A statement from the FCDO said:

“We recognise this is a fast-moving situation that poses significant risks. The situation has the potential to deteriorate further, quickly and without warning.”

The warning notes that missile fragments have already caused injuries, and a nationwide state of emergency remains in effect in Israel, declared on Friday (June 13) after Israel’s surprise strikes on nuclear and military targets inside Iran.

Those strikes are believed to have killed several Iranian generals and nuclear scientists, further inflaming tensions.


Airspace Closure and Travel Insurance Risks

The UK government emphasised that Israeli airspace remains closed, and warns that:

  • Road links and border crossings may be disrupted without notice

  • Falling missile debris poses a direct threat to civilians

  • Ignoring FCDO guidance could invalidate travel insurance

Additionally, red zones now include Gaza, the West Bank, the Golan Heights, and all of Israel proper under the new advisory.


UK Military Precautionary Deployment

Prime Minister Sir Keir Starmer confirmed on Saturday that additional RAF Typhoon jets and refuelling aircraft have been sent to the region to protect British assets.

Speaking on Sky News, Chancellor Rachel Reeves clarified:

“No, it does not mean that we are at war. And we have not been involved in these strikes or this conflict, but we do have important assets in the region and it is right that we send jets to protect them.”
